Tom Aspinall surprises and names favorite for Conor McGregor vs. Max Holloway at UFC 329.

The champion believes Conor McGregor's knockout power remains intact and is betting on a victory for the Irishman, despite his long period of inactivity.

Not even the long period of inactivity was enough to make Tom aspinall doubt Conor McGregorThe heavyweight champion (up to 120,2 kg) stated that the knockout power The Irishman's record remains intact, and he revealed his belief that the former two-division champion will emerge victorious against... Max Holloway in the main fight of UFC 329, on July 11, in Las Vegas.

 

In a video posted to his YouTube channel, Aspinall stated that McGregor's main weapon remains his ability to end a fight with a single punch. Although he acknowledges that the time away from the octagon raises doubts, the champion believes that this characteristic remains intact.

“I believe his power remains. To be honest, I’m more inclined to believe in McGregor’s victory,” declared the heavyweight champion.

Despite betting on the Irishman, Tom aspinall He made a point of highlighting that Holloway represents a huge challenge. According to him, the former featherweight champion possesses characteristics that make life difficult for any opponent, such as a high volume of strikes, excellent stamina, and physical conditioning that allows him to maintain an intense pace throughout the fight.

The fight will mark McGregor's return to the UFC for the first time since July 2021, when he suffered a serious leg fracture against... Dustin poirierMeanwhile, the Hawaiian arrives riding a wave of great performances and tries to capitalize on the moment to spoil the return of one of the biggest stars in the organization's history.

Period of inactivity increases pressure on McGregor

At 37 years old, McGregor is trying to end a drought that has lasted more than six years. His last victory was in January 2020, when he defeated... Donald Cerrone in just 40 seconds. Since then, the Irishman has suffered two consecutive defeats to Dustin poirier and did not return to competition after suffering a serious leg fracture during a fight held in July 2021.

The long period away from the sport has transformed the duel against Holloway into one of the most important moments of his recent career. A victory could put the former champion back among the organization's top topics, while another defeat would increase doubts about his ability to compete at a high level.

First fight between Conor McGregor and Max Holloway

The fight took place at UFC Fight Night 26 in Boston in August 2013, early in both fighters' UFC careers. Conor had the advantage, winning by unanimous decision. The fight occurred years before the Irishman won the featherweight title (up to 65,7 kg) in 2015 and became the first to win the title in two weight classes in the UFC, in 2016 against Eddie Alvarez in the lightweight division.

Max Holloway, was BMF champion, won against Justin gaethje No. UFC 300, with a historic knockout in the final seconds and defended against Dustin poirier, before losing to Charles Oliveira at UFC 326 in March. Before moving up a weight class, the Hawaiian won the featherweight title and defended it four times.
